Been playing Backyard Baseball ’01 for a couple months now. It’s basically a classic baseball game with the Backyard Sports kids – you can create your own team, customize their uniforms, and play through a full season or just do pick-up games. There’s a ton of different characters to choose from, both Backyard kids and pro legends, which is pretty cool. The gameplay is easy to pick up but there’s still some strategy involved in things like positioning your players and managing your lineup. And the graphics hold up really well, even on older phones. Took me a while to get used to the controls but once you figure them out it’s pretty smooth.
Look, if you’re a fan of baseball or the Backyard Sports series, you’ll probably have a blast with this. It’s not super deep or anything, but it’s a fun casual game that just makes you smile. I’d say it’s a pretty good time killer when you’ve got a few minutes to spare.
Editor Opinion
So here's my take on Backyard Baseball '01 - I've tested a bunch of sports and baseball games on my phone, and this one's definitely one of the better ones. The Backyard Sports style is really charming and nostalgic, and the gameplay is just simple and fun. It's not the most complex or realistic baseball sim out there, but it doesn't try to be. The controls are intuitive and the games are pretty quick, which makes it perfect for quick sessions. The season mode has enough depth to keep you coming back, but it never feels like a grind. Honestly, my only real complaint is that it can get a little repetitive after a while, but that's kind of expected for a game like this. Overall, it's a solid, feel-good baseball game that's worth checking out.
